Identity theft isn't just credit card fraud. By the time you find out your identity has been compromised often through a letter from a bank you've never heard of, the damage is already done. Criminals use stolen personal information to open new lines of credit, file fraudulent tax returns, take over medical accounts, and drain savings. Recovery can take years and cost thousands in legal fees and lost wages.
A dedicated monitoring service watches for your personal information across credit bureaus, the dark web, financial databases, and public records alerting you the moment something suspicious surfaces. The earlier you catch it, the less it costs to fix. Every day without coverage is a day you're flying blind.

Not every service monitors the same sources or responds with the same urgency. Here's exactly what I look for before recommending any identity protection product:

Three-Bureau Credit Monitoring
Experian, TransUnion, and Equifax each maintain separate files. Monitoring only one bureau means you're missing two-thirds of the picture. Insist on all three.

Dark Web Surveillance
This is where stolen credentials are bought and sold. Your service must actively scan criminal marketplaces for your SSN, email addresses, passwords, and financial account numbers.

Theft Insurance Coverage
If identity theft happens despite protection, you need financial backup. Look for at least $1 million in coverage for stolen funds, legal fees, and lost wages not $25,000.

U.S.-Based Restoration Support
Alerts are only half the job. You need a dedicated case manager who will guide you through every step of recovery — not a chatbot and a FAQ page.

Alert Speed
Hours matter. The faster a service notifies you of suspicious activity, the smaller the window criminals have to cause irreversible damage. Real-time alerts are non-negotiable.

Family Coverage
Children's Social Security numbers are among the most commonly stolen — they go years without being discovered. A strong family plan covers every member, including minors.

Credit monitoring tracks changes to your credit file new accounts, hard inquiries, and score changes. Identity theft protection goes much further: it also watches the dark web, public records, criminal databases, Social Security usage, medical records, and financial accounts. Think of credit monitoring as one layer inside a much larger system. The best services combine both, plus active restoration support if something goes wrong.
No service can guarantee prevention if your data is exposed in a breach at a company you've never heard of, there's nothing a monitoring service could have done to stop it. What these services do extremely well is detect threats quickly and minimize the damage window. The earlier you're alerted, the faster you can freeze accounts, dispute fraudulent activity, and shut down unauthorized use before it escalates.
Yes, they protect against completely different threats. Antivirus protects your devices from malware. A VPN protects your network traffic. Identity protection monitors your personal information across external databases, credit bureaus, and criminal networks places your antivirus can't see. All three serve distinct purposes and none of them replace each other.

Without professional help, the FTC estimates the average recovery takes 200 hours of personal effort spread over months or years. With a dedicated case manager from a monitoring service, that timeline compresses significantly. The difference between a service that sends alerts and one that assigns you a real human to work through the process is enormous — it's one of the most important factors when choosing a provider.
